ARTESIA MUNICIPAL WATER SYSTEM (PWSID NM3520308) is a cws water system drawing from a groundwater source, regulated by the E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S) under the Safe Drinking Water Act. It serves approximately 15,176 people in Artesia, NM, and is subject to primacy enforcement by the New Mexico drinking-water program.

The system's federal compliance record contains 34 total violations, with 34 classified as health-based (MCL exceedances or treatment-technique failures). 2 distinct contaminants have been cited, including Fluoride, E. coli. Recorded violations span 2017–2017.

A historical violation does not necessarily describe current water quality, systems must notify customers and remediate, and monitoring-type violations often reflect reporting lapses rather than contamination. The most authoritative real-time source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the New Mexico state drinking-water program's public portal.
